Jumeirah to hire for new hotel opening in Dubai

Dubai-based Jumeirah Group is hiring hoteliers for its hotel to be opened in Dubai over the next couple of months.

The hotel will employ around 400 people for its Jumeirah Creekside Hotel in Garhoud (Dubai) to be opened in the fall of 2011, a hotel spokesperson told Emirates 24l7.

The group has just completed recruitment of 900 hoteliers for its Jumeirah at Etihad Towers in Abu Dhabi which will take reservations as of November 1.

“We’ve had two open recruitment days (for Etihad Towers) in Dubai in April which were very successful and another recruitment day (on invitation for pre-screened candidates) is took place on July 25 in Dubai.  We are planning to open the hotel with about 900 colleagues,” the spokeswoman said, adding that “we will open the Jumeirah Creekside Hotel in Garhoud (Dubai) in the fall of 2011, employing around 400 colleagues. (But) no recruitment fair is scheduled (for Creedside Hotel). Our Development team is always looking at potential partnerships with owners/developers in the region and around the world.”

The group, according to the website, will open six new properties around the world during this year. Frankfurt Jumeirah, Germany, is the latest addition to its global brand network. Three new hotels have already been opened in the first fourth months of 2011.

Recently, Jumeirah said it recorded better occupancy during the first four months of 2011, averaging out at 85 per cent over with RevPAR rising by over seven per cent compared to the same period in 2010. Robust growth was recorded in business hotels in Dubai, New York and London.
